6. LEGAL BASES FOR PROCESSING — EEA, UK, AND OTHER APPLICABLE JURISDICTIONS

Where applicable, including for individuals in the European Economic Area (EEA) and United Kingdom, we process personal information on one or more of the following legal bases:

Contract: where processing is necessary to provide products or Services you have requested, including processing and fulfilling orders.

Legal obligation: where processing is necessary to comply with applicable laws or regulatory requirements.

Legitimate interests: where processing is necessary for purposes such as operating and improving our business, preventing fraud, maintaining security, and protecting our legal rights, provided those interests are not overridden by your rights.

Consent: where you have provided consent for a particular processing activity, including certain marketing communications or non-essential cookies.

Where processing is based on consent, you may withdraw your consent at any time. Withdrawal does not affect the lawfulness of processing carried out before withdrawal.
